Uploaded image for project: 'Jackrabbit Oak'
  1. Jackrabbit Oak
  2. OAK-9208

Log unexpected writes to the paths designated as part of a non-default mount

    XMLWordPrintableJSON

Details

    • Improvement
    • Status: Closed
    • Major
    • Resolution: Fixed
    • None
    • 1.36.0
    • composite
    • None

    Description

      When populating a composite mount there are certain components that write content to it. Some of them are declarative and make it easy to infer the output, e.g. content package installer and Sling's repoinit.

      Others are unpredictable, such as OSGi components/activators.

      It would be useful to report such "unexpected" writes so that they can be analysed and disabled. The analyser would get the mount information from the MountInfoProvider and report:

      • when such writes occur
      • a stack trace of the write operation

      Attachments

        Issue Links

          Activity

            People

              rombert Robert Munteanu
              rombert Robert Munteanu
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: